Easy hiking trails around Avallon are characterized by the region's diverse geography, situated on the edge of the Morvan Regional Nature Park. The terrain features rolling hills, dense forests, and river valleys, including the scenic Cousin Valley. Avallon itself is positioned on an elevated promontory, offering views of the surrounding countryside and historical ramparts. This landscape provides varied opportunities for easy walks, with gentle gradients and picturesque vistas.

Best easy hiking trails around Avallon

  • The most popular easy hiking route is Noyers-sur-Serein – The washhouse loop from Noyers, a 2.2 miles (3.5 km) trail that takes 55 minutes to complete. This route features minimal elevation gain, making it suitable for a relaxed walk.
  • Another top favourite among local hikers is Panorama of the Cure – Statues of Farmers and Cow loop from Domecy-sur-Cure, an easy 3.0 miles (4.9 km) path. This trail offers views of the Cure Valley and passes by local landmarks.
  • Local hikers also love the Avallon – Avallon Clock Tower loop from Avallon, a 3.1 miles (5.0 km) trail leading through the town and surrounding areas, often completed in about 1 hour 27 minutes.

This church, dedicated to the Holy Cross (Latin: "Santa Croce"), derives its patronage from the cross on which Jesus Christ died. The veneration of the Holy Cross is largely based on Saint Helena, the mother of Emperor Constantine the Great (who, after his victory at the Milvian Bridge in Rome, recognized Christianity as a religion and ended the long period of persecution with the Edict of Toleration of Milan in 312). She made a pilgrimage to the Holy Land (Israel/Palestine) in the early fourth century and brought numerous relics back to Europe, including the "True Cross," on which Jesus Christ was crucified. Helena is therefore often depicted with a cross as an attribute. The Church celebrates the Feast of the Discovery, public presentation, and veneration of the Holy Cross—called the "Exaltation of the Holy Cross"—on September 14th.

The remarkable "Tour de l'horloge" in Avallon is a massive gate tower integrated into the city wall and dates back to the 14th century, while the rare clock dates back to the 15th century.

On the Cure, the very old bridge of St-Père, remodeled several times, has kept its appearance from the end of the 18th century. It is difficult to date the first stone bridge. Like the Asquins bridge, it is very important due to its history and location. A Roman bridge may have existed at St Père, each bank being bordered by a Roman road. In the Middle Ages and after, the Cure separated the Duchy of Burgundy, the County of Nevers and the royal lands and St Père was located on strategic and very busy communication routes. In addition, the town was very close to the rich abbey and basilica of Vézelay and Avallon, therefore on a famous pilgrimage route.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many easy hiking trails are available around Avallon?

There are 141 easy hiking trails around Avallon. These routes are designed with gentle gradients, making them suitable for a relaxed walk through the region's diverse landscapes.

What kind of terrain can I expect on easy hikes near Avallon?

Easy hikes around Avallon feature a varied terrain, including rolling hills, dense forests, and picturesque river valleys such as the scenic Cousin Valley. Avallon itself is situated on an elevated promontory, offering walks with views of the surrounding countryside.

Are there easy circular hiking routes in the Avallon area?

Yes, many easy trails around Avallon are circular, allowing you to start and end at the same point. An example is the Vézelay Hill Loop, which offers a pleasant walk with scenic views.

What natural features or viewpoints can I discover on easy trails?

The easy trails often lead to stunning natural features and viewpoints. You can explore the tranquil Cousin Valley, or enjoy the panoramic View from the Rocher de la Pérouse. Some routes also pass by unique formations like the Roche Percée.

Are the easy hiking trails around Avallon suitable for families with children?

Yes, the easy hiking trails around Avallon are generally very suitable for families. Their gentle gradients and manageable distances make them ideal for children. Consider routes like Vézelay – Vézelay town gate loop from Vézelay for a family-friendly outing.

Can I bring my dog on the easy hiking trails in Avallon?

Many trails in the Morvan Regional Nature Park area, including those around Avallon, are dog-friendly. However, it's always advisable to keep dogs on a leash, especially in nature reserves or near livestock, and to check local regulations for specific routes. The Noyers-sur-Serein – Old Castle of Siguer loop from Noyers is a good option for a walk with your canine companion.

What is the best time of year to go easy hiking in Avallon?

The best time for easy hiking in Avallon is typically from spring to autumn. During these seasons, the weather is generally mild, and the landscapes of the Morvan Regional Nature Park are vibrant with lush greenery or beautiful autumn colors. Summer offers longer daylight hours, while spring and autumn provide cooler temperatures ideal for walking.

Are there any historical landmarks or attractions along the easy hiking routes?

Yes, many easy hiking routes incorporate historical landmarks. You can walk along the ancient ramparts of Avallon itself, or visit sites like the Notre-Dame Church of Saint-Père. The Saint Peter's Church – Notre-Dame Church loop from Tonnerre is an example of a trail that passes by historical points of interest.
